Introduction: Why are you trying to simplify your life?

We all have personal obstacles to overcome. Some are simple and some are complicated. The topic of simplification is personal to everyone, but it’s also what we strive for every day.

We know about the benefits of simplifying your life, but why do you want to simplify? One reason for this is that it forces you to prioritize tasks and improve efficiency. This leads to more time for self-care, family time, and other activities that make up your life.

Some people simplify their lives because they’re feeling overwhelmed by the “busyness” of modern society or that there simply isn’t enough time in the day for everything they want to do. Others simplify their lives by moving into a tiny home or having kids so they can live a simpler lifestyle with fewer responsibilities and more freedom.

Don’t Let Stress Make You Sick – Understand the Science of Stress and How To Manage it Properly

Stress is a natural part of life, but it can be harmful if not managed properly. In this article, we will take a look at how stress affects the body and what science says about managing it.

What does stress do to your body?

Stress is a natural part of life and can be healthy when managed properly. However, when we’re under too much stress our bodies may react in unhealthy ways. These reactions can range from physical and mental to hormonal issues and inflammation that can lead to various health problems in the future.

Different strategies for managing stress:

Mindfulness meditation

Mindfulness meditation is a form of meditation that focuses on being aware of what is going on in the present moment. It is a practice that helps people to live more consciously and with greater awareness.

By practicing mindfulness, we can cultivate a deeper sense of happiness and contentment by learning how to be in the moment when we are experiencing joy or when we are facing challenges.

Mindfulness meditation has been used by many companies in the workplace for their employees to help them cope with stress, anxiety, and other mental health concerns.

Mental relaxation techniques

Technology is often used as a tool to help us relax our minds. There are many different types of technology that people use to relax their minds. One common type of mental relaxation technique is meditation.

It is important to find the right type of meditation for you. If you prefer to do something physical, then yoga and tai chi are two options that might be beneficial for you. If you like listening or singing, then playing certain types of music might help you too.

There are also apps on the market right now that can help us relieve stress and anxiety with guided imagery exercises and soundscapes for meditation sessions.

Physical exercise/exercise therapy

Physical exercise and exercise therapy are two huge parts of Eastern and Western cultures, but it is also used as a treatment for health conditions such as obesity, high blood pressure, and depression.

2. Give Up Spending Money on Things You Don’t Need

One of the ways to improve our happiness and well-being is to give up spending money on things that we don’t need. It will help us save a lot of time, energy, and resources.

There are many reasons why you need to Give Up Spending Money on Things You Don’t Need. One is that it will make a positive impact on your bank account – saving more money in the long run. Another reason is that it will help you become more mindful about what you spend your money on and how much you actually spend.

3. Get Rid of Social Media for a while

Sometimes it’s best to take a break from social media. This is because it can be overwhelming and cause anxiety to people. If you’re feeling anxious, it might be time for a break to help your mental health.

Get rid of social media for a while, but why?

Some reasons include being overwhelmed with the amount of content that is coming your way, not being able to keep up with the amount of content you need to produce, using social media as an escape route when you are feeling anxious or depressed, or getting addicted to social media and its apps.

4. Leave your phone at home when you’re out

Today, it is common to be surrounded by all kinds of screens. We rely not only on our phones but many other devices for a variety of things including entertainment, productivity, and communication.

However, studies show that this reliance can have a negative impact on our mental health and wellbeing.

In addition to the physical effects of spending so much time in front of screens – there are also serious mental health problems that arise from constantly checking our phones without realizing how much time we’re taking away from activities that really matter.

Although it can be difficult staying away from technology when you’re out with friends or family, doing so is important for your personal well-being and happiness.
